75. Governments Recognize Benefits of Visa Facilitation
Visa facilitation has experienced strong progress in recent years, particularly through the implementation of visa on arrival policies. According to the UNWTO’s latest Visa Openness Report, 62% of the world’s population required a traditional visa prior to departure in 2014, down from 77% in 2008. 76. Over 97 Million People Visit Florida in 2014
According to preliminary estimates released by Visit Florida, the state’s official tourism marketing corporation, 97.3 million people visited Florida in 2014, an increase of 3.9% over 2013. 78. Bangkok Airways Takes Delivery of Airbus A319
Bangkok Airways has taken delivery of its latest Airbus A319. The aircraft, which is configured with 144 Economy Class seats, will be used on domestic routes within Thailand such as Samui, Phuket, Udon Thani and Chiang Mai.
